    The TCL 5 series is an excellent TV. It's 4K, HDR, and has Dolby Vision and has ROKU built in. What more could you ask for at this price point? The picture quality is terrific, the ROKU OS is the simplest and best OS on TV's today. Roku allows you to download any app you want while other major TV Mfg's sometimes don't allow you specific apps on their TV's. I also own a 4 series and 6 series now. The 4 series is ok but the 5 is better and depending on when the sales are on I would grab a 5 series over 4 if possible. Now the 6 series blows them both away but depending on where you intend to use the TV you can save the cash and buy a 4 or 5 series, they are both really nice. The noticeable difference to me in the 5 series over the 4 series is the brightness of the TV, the contrast is very good, the blacks are better as well, very low input lag (gaming) and the aesthetics of the TV are nicer on the 5. The 5 is a metal finish while the 4 series is a nice black plastic trim around the screen. My son uses the 5 series to play his Xbox games and to watch TV & Movies. Buy it, you won't regret it.

    55” model is outstanding for the price. I bought this model after extensive research for four main reasons: Pros: 1. Color accuracy out-of-the-box and even better after little calibration. It requires very little adjustment and even if one made no adjustments, most would still be happy with the picture. It also has a wide color gamut. 2. Support for all major 4K digital formats. Most TV’s in this price range only have HDR and not Dolby Vision. This set has both (and HLG). 3. It removes motion judder from all 24p sources. This improves motion handling whether watching 4K movies or even Movies over Cable sources. 4. Excellent upscaling of HD, 1080i, and 720p sources, especially those from over-the-air or a Cale box. Cons: 1. A little bit of dirty screen effect although I only notice it when running test patterns on YouTube. 2. 60hz panel although that’s expected at this price as no TV under $500 has a native 120hz panel. 3. Doesn’t get bright enough with HDR sources. If you got the cash for the TCL 6 series, go for that. Otherwise, get this over other sets in this price range including its closer competitor the Hisense H8F which has serious reliability issues being reported.

    This is one of the great budget TV for the price it has, and for the generally fair to good performance, it offers. This mid-range TCL TV offers elegant gaming performance, superior response time for smooth content motion, and gives really strong overall picture quality in both a dark room and a well-lit space due to its decent brightness and great contrast ratio. Its color performance is also good, which makes the S525’s HDR quality surprisingly vibrant. This is a great example of an affordable-yet-fantastic screen. The TCL 5 series also wins on its style. Its thin, minimalist metal cabinet looks way nicer than the bulky plastic of the equivalently priced other TVs, something which might give it an even easier sell for your family.

    HDR is consistent much better than previous TV. 3 hdmi 2.0 ports and an HDMI Arc Port. Different tv picture/audio settings can be saved between inputs. Many Roku channels to choose from. USB port on TV. I have owned this tv almost a year and it still holds up pretty well. 4K 60 is beautiful. No color bleed or dead pixels. Worth it!
